The phenotype of adverse drug effects: Do emergency visits due to adverse drug reactions look different in older people? Results from the ADRED study

Study analysing cases of ADRs in emergency departments (n=2215, Germany) found differences in symptoms of ADRs between adults and older individuals, with confusion, dehydration, bradycardia, GI/rectal bleeds and falls more likely in older adults.
